Here are some guidelines on how to determine which company has the best deal.

Insurance plans for car rentals vary depending on age, place of residence and duration of insurance. Note that the premium is directly proportional to your age group. So the first thing you need to do is determine where you are going. State or country specific insurance plans are cheaper than insurance plans that cover unlimited travel. You also need to determine how often you will be traveling. The annual rate is usually cheaper than the daily rate. If you can determine how often you travel in six or twelve months, you can determine which contract is cheaper.
